🏛️ Official Statutory Public Holidays Applicable in Cuautlalpan

These are Mexico's official statutory fixed-date public holidays — the same national list shown on Mexico's country and Mexico City holiday pages — mandated by national labor law and applicable to financial institutions, schools, and government administration in Cuautlalpan just as everywhere else in Mexico.

Holiday NameFixed DateCategoryClosure StatusOfficial Source
Benito Juárez DayMarch 21Federal Holiday (Ley Federal del Trabajo)Full Federal Closure (Mandatory Paid Rest Day under Art. 74)www.gob.mx
Labor Day (Día del Trabajo)May 1Federal HolidayFull Federal Closurewww.gob.mx
Independence Day (Día de la Independencia)September 16Federal HolidayFull Federal Closure (Banks & Schools Closed)www.gob.mx
Revolution Day (Día de la Revolución)November 20Federal HolidayFull Federal Closurewww.gob.mx

📖 Public Holidays & Business Operating Hours in Cuautlalpan

Businesses in Cuautlalpan generally follow the same statutory closure pattern as the rest of Mexico: banks and government offices close fully, while retail and hospitality tend to trim hours rather than close for the day.

A statutory holiday falling on a Saturday or Sunday in Cuautlalpan doesn't simply get skipped — Mexico's gazette process typically moves the observed day off to the following Monday.
